Paperback. Etat : New. Print on Demand. This book examines the complex relationship between farm exports, agricultural pricing, and government programs in the United States. It traces the decline in agricultural exports in the 1950s, the impact of this decline on farm prices and farm income, and the government's efforts to expand foreign markets for agricultural products. The author argues that the government's focus on expanding exports has led to a system of agricultural subsidies that has benefited large-scale farmers at the expense of small-scale farmers and consumers. The book also examines the environmental impact of government farm policies, arguing that these policies have contributed to soil erosion, water pollution, and the loss of biodiversity. The author concludes by calling for a more sustainable and equitable agricultural policy that supports small-scale farmers, protects the environment, and ensures that all Americans have access to affordable, healthy food.
